2014 VW Golf R Mk 7 teased ahead of Geneva debut

Mon, 28 Jan 2013

Volkswagen has started the tease for the Mk 7 Golf R with the new Golf R hidden in a block of ice as a ‘Frozen Beast’ ahead of a Geneva 2013 debut. Now that Volkswagen has the Mk7 Golf in the wild – and the MK 7 VW GTi too – they’re ready to turn the wick up to 11 with the launch of the MK 7 Golf R – or at least the concept version – at the 2013 Geneva Motor Show. And now they’re starting to tease.

Mitsubishi weighs a 'different direction' for the Lancer Evolution

Fri, 04 Mar 2011

The current generation of Mitsubishi Motors Corp.'s Lancer Evolution high-performance sedan appears be its last as the automaker works to refashion itself as a leader in electrified vehicles. Mitsubishi is considering a "different direction" for its rally-inspired, all-wheel-drive sport sedan as it prepares to launch eight electric or plug-in hybrid vehicles globally by 2015. The plan is fueled in part by a need to meet tougher global fuel economy and emissions regulations.

Kia, Chrysler, VW set pace as December sales advance 9 percent

Wed, 04 Jan 2012

Kia, Chrysler and Volkswagen posted some of the strongest sales gains for December as the industry closed out 2011 on a high note. Automotive News estimates December volume was up 9 percent to 1.24 million from a year earlier--in line with analysts' forecasts. Total industry sales were projected at 12.78 million for the year, up from 2010's total of 11.6 million and the 27-year low of 10.4 million in 2009.
